Libertarian Running For Indiana Seat In Congress Talks 'Liberty'

Russell Brooksbank For Congress Facebook page

This year’s race for Congress in Indiana’s 9th District includes a third-party candidate who says the federal government is heading down the wrong path.

Libertarian Russell Brooksbank lives in Clarksville, where he’s a diesel mechanic and chief steward in the Teamsters Union Local 89. The Army veteran has previously been a candidate for state representative and Clarksville Town Council.

Brooksbank faces Democrat Shelli Yoder and Republican Trey Hollingsworth in the November General Election. I spoke with him about his run for the U.S. House seat.
